Perhaps the most vital role etvshow.com plays is as a cultural tether for the Ethiopian diaspora. With millions of Ethiopians living in North America, Europe, and the Middle East, access to local TV broadcasts is often difficult or impossible due to geo-restrictions or time differences.
etvshow.com solves this problem by offering an on-demand library that allows expatriates to stay connected to the cultural pulse of their homeland. For many, watching a new episode of a favorite drama on the website is a weekly ritual that maintains a sense of identity and belonging.

Most shows on ETVShow.com are copyrighted by Ethiopian Broadcasting Service (EBS), Fana TV, or Oromia Media Network. Unless the website has explicit licensing agreements (which has never been publicly confirmed), hosting these shows without permission likely constitutes copyright infringement.
However, enforcement of digital copyright in Ethiopia is still developing. The government has historically turned a blind eye to such archiving sites because they indirectly promote Ethiopian culture globally. That said, copyright holders could file a DMCA takedown request at any time, which is why domains sometimes change or disappear.
